Transaction 068bfc2335eadf88639f1303a8584c2c10d33dbbb3da140f30b3b7ae1ab01834

1 Input
2 Outputs
  • 068bfc2335eadf88639f1303a8584c2c10d33dbbb3da140f30b3b7ae1ab01834:0
  • value  12966500
    address  3Kmja3RvVEBvahSxgkLaSYpiuwYGcNga5Y
  • 068bfc2335eadf88639f1303a8584c2c10d33dbbb3da140f30b3b7ae1ab01834:1
  • value  8551015
    address  34QYKMMz4Anz25ocUGYfD7Nf3hmecvdk1x